Cloud_Mask
: Array of 32 bit Integers [Byte_Segment_mod35 = 0..5][nscans_10_MODIS_Swath_Type_GEO = 0..59][mframes_MODIS_Swath_Type_GEO = 0..40]
Byte_Segment_mod35:
nscans_10_MODIS_Swath_Type_GEO:
mframes_MODIS_Swath_Type_GEO:
valid_range: 0, 255 _FillValue: 0 long_name: MODIS Cloud Mask and Spectral Test Results units: none scale_factor: 1.0000000000000000 add_offset: 0.0000000000000000 Parameter_Type: Output Cell_Along_Swath_Sampling: 1, 2030, 1 Cell_Across_Swath_Sampling: 1, 1354, 1 Geolocation_Pointer: External MODIS geolocation product description: Bit fields within each byte are numbered from the left: 7, 6, 5, 4, 3, 2, 1, 0. The left-most bit (bit 7) is the most significant bit. The right-most bit (bit 0) is the least significant bit. bit field Description Key --------- ----------- --- 0 Cloud Mask Flag 0 = Not determined 1 = Determined 2, 1 Unobstructed FOV Quality Flag 00 = Cloudy 01 = Uncertain 10 = Probably Clear 11 = Confident Clear PROCESSING PATH --------------- 3 Day or Night Path 0 = Night / 1 = Day 4 Sunglint Path 0 = Yes / 1 = No 5 Snow/Ice Background Path 0 = Yes / 1 = No 7, 6 Land or Water Path 00 = Water 01 = Coastal 10 = Desert 11 = Land ____ END BYTE 1 ______________ ___________________________________________ bit field Description Key --------- ----------- --- ADDITIONAL INFORMATION ---------------------- 0 Non- cloud obstruction Flag 0 = Yes / 1 = No 1 Thin Cirrus Detected (Solar) 0 = Yes / 1 = No 2 Shadow Found 0 = Yes / 1 = No 3 Thin Cirrus Detected (Infrared) 0 = Yes / 1 = No 4 Adjacent Cloud Detected ** 0 = Yes / 1 = No ** Implemented Post Launch to Indicate cloud found within surrounding 1 km pixels * 1-km CLOUD FLAGS ---------------- 5 Cloud Flag - IR Threshold 0 = Yes / 1 = No 6 High Cloud Flag - CO2 Test 0 = Yes / 1 = No 7 High Cloud Flag - 6.7 micron Test 0 = Yes / 1 = No ____ END BYTE 2 ______________ ___________________________________________ bit field Description Key --------- ----------- --- 0 High Cloud Flag - 1.38 micron Test 0 = Yes / 1 = No 1 High Cloud Flag - 3.7- 12 micron Test 0 = Yes / 1 = No 2 Cloud Flag - IR Temperature 0 = Yes / 1 = No Difference 3 Cloud Flag - 3.7- 11 micron Test 0 = Yes / 1 = No 4 Cloud Flag - Visible Reflectance Test 0 = Yes / 1 = No 5 Cloud Flag - Visible Reflectance 0 = Yes / 1 = No Ratio Test 6 Cloud Flag - NDVI Final Confidence 0 = Yes / 1 = No Confirmation Test 7 Cloud Flag - Night 7.3- 11 micron Test 0 = Yes / 1 = No ____ END BYTE 3 ______________ ___________________________________________ bit field Description Key --------- ----------- --- ADDITIONAL TESTS ---------------- 0 Cloud Flag - Spare 0 = Yes / 1 = No 1 Cloud Flag - Spatial Variability 0 = Yes / 1 = No 2 Final Confidence Confirmation Test 0 = Yes / 1 = No 3 Cloud Flag - Night Water 0 = Yes / 1 = No Spatial Variability 4 Suspended Dust Flag 0 = Yes / 1 = No 5-7 Spares ____ END BYTE 4 ______________ ___________________________________________ bit field Description Key --------- ----------- --- 250-m Cloud Flag - Visible Tests -------------------------------- 0 Element(1,1) 0 = Yes / 1 = No 1 Element(1,2) 0 = Yes / 1 = No 2 Element(1,3) 0 = Yes / 1 = No 3 Element(1,4) 0 = Yes / 1 = No 4 Element(2,1) 0 = Yes / 1 = No 5 Element(2,2) 0 = Yes / 1 = No 6 Element(2,3) 0 = Yes / 1 = No 7 Element(2,4) 0 = Yes / 1 = No ____ END BYTE 5 ______________ ___________________________________________ bit field Description Key ---------- ----------- --- 0 Element(3,1) 0 = Yes / 1 = No 1 Element(3,2) 0 = Yes / 1 = No 2 Element(3,3) 0 = Yes / 1 = No 3 Element(3,4) 0 = Yes / 1 = No 4 Element(4,1) 0 = Yes / 1 = No 5 Element(4,2) 0 = Yes / 1 = No 6 Element(4,3) 0 = Yes / 1 = No 7 Element(4,4) 0 = Yes / 1 = No ____ END BYTE 6 ______________ ___________________________________________ coordinates: Byte_Segment_mod35 Latitude Longitude
